Transaction 230021754eccc842c02b39dbfcba68399fae7076b78a12b0b46546bd141606f0
1 Input
1 Output
-
230021754eccc842c02b39dbfcba68399fae7076b78a12b0b46546bd141606f0:0
- value
- 1230194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efc1f284eeb0afae560f29d1084decb2bbb3f2fb OP_EQUAL
- address
- 3PYjm66gnMpSx5xwj9deq32SB64C9yMMWP